Yūji Hoshi ( Japanese 星 雄 次 , Hoshi Yūji ; born July 27, 1992 in Kanagawa Prefecture ) is a Japanese football player .

Career

Yūji Hoshi learned to play football in the youth team of the Yokohama F. Marinos and in the university team of the Hōsei University . He signed his first contract with Fukushima United FC in 2015 . The club from Fukushima , a city in the Fukushima prefecture of the same name in the northeast of the main island of Honshū , played in the third division, the J3 League . After a season he left the club and in 2016 joined the second division promoted Renofa Yamaguchi FC from Yamaguchi . By the end of 2017 he was on the pitch for Renofa 59 times in the second division. In 2018 he moved to Ōita Trinita, who also played in the second division, on a free transfer . With the club from Ōita , he became runner-up in the J2 League at the end of 2018 and rose to the first division.
